“The Others Among Us, Part 6”

In "The Others Among Us, Part 6," Martian Manhunter faces a moral crossroads when a fellow Martian is linked to two murders, forcing him to navigate tense alliances with Superman and Batman. With Alfred's help—obtained in defiance of Batman's orders—J'onn pushes forward, uncovering critical truths in a story written by A. J. Lieberman and illustrated by Al Barrionuevo, with inks by BIT, colors by Marta Martinez, and letters by John J. Hill. The cover, also by Al Barrionuevo, captures the weight of the moment.
